Overpriced Gems: Finding Inflated Rates



When it involves vintage car offers, it is very important to be able to find filled with air costs, ensuring that you don't wind up overpaying for a gem that might not deserve its weight in gold. One vital sign of a filled with air price is when the vendor asks for considerably greater than the market value of the auto.

Research the average selling price for similar models and contrast it to the asking price. One more red flag is when the vendor tries to justify the high rate by stressing rare features or declaring that the vehicle remains in excellent problem.

Make the effort to extensively examine the lorry and verify its credibility. Do not hesitate to bargain and leave if the rate does not straighten with the automobile's real worth. Remember, perseverance and due diligence will save you from coming under the catch of overpaying for a classic car.

Hidden Corrosion: Uncovering Hidden Cars And Truck Concerns



To stay clear of potential problems, it's critical to thoroughly check a vintage car for surprise rust and other underlying auto issues.

Concealed rust can be a significant trouble when getting a classic car, as it can result in structural damage and costly repair services. When checking for corrosion, pay very close attention to locations such as the wheel wells, rocker panels, and undercarriage. Look for bubbling or blistering paint, as this can suggest corrosion developing underneath. Additionally, make use of a magnet to check for areas that may have been fixed with bondo or filler, as these can be hiding areas for rust.

It's additionally important to examine the structure and suspension elements for signs of rust or corrosion.
